What is the Fiverr Freelancer Income Calculator?

The Fiverr Freelancer Income Calculator helps digital creators, designers, developers, writers, and freelancers calculate their true net take-home earnings instead of relying strictly on gross gig prices.

Fiverr deducts a standard 20% service commission fee from all earnings (including gig extras and client tips). This calculator allows you to input your average package prices, extras, software subscriptions, and payout withdrawal costs to see your actual net profit per month and per day.

Formula

Gross Earnings = (Base Package + Gig Extras + Tips) × Orders

Fiverr Platform Cut = Gross Earnings × 20%

Net Take-Home Profit = Gross Earnings − Fiverr Cut − Software & Withdrawal Expenses

How does Fiverr calculate its seller service fee?

Fiverr charges a flat 20% platform commission fee on all seller revenues. This 20% cut applies to base order prices, gig extras, custom offers, and even customer tips.

How long does it take to clear earnings on Fiverr?

Standard sellers (New, Level 1, and Level 2) must wait 14 days after order completion for funds to clear. Top Rated Sellers, Fiverr Pro, and Fiverr Choice members enjoy a fast-tracked 7-day clearance window.

Does Fiverr take a 20% cut on tips?

Yes. Fiverr deducts its 20% platform fee from all incoming revenue, including tips left by buyers upon order completion.

What withdrawal fees should I account for?

Depending on your location and payout method, Payoneer, PayPal, or Bank Transfer services may charge transaction fees or currency conversion spreads ($1 to $3 per transfer or 1-3% currency conversion loss).

How can I increase my net income as a Fiverr freelancer?

Boost profitability by upselling Gig Extras, creating tiered packages (Basic, Standard, Premium), offering fast-track delivery options, and building long-term off-platform retainer workflows where appropriate.
